Family & Community Services is above average in terms of popularity with it being the #233 most popular bachelor's degree program in the country. This means you won't have too much trouble finding schools that offer the degree.

College Factual reviewed 2 schools in the New England Region to determine which ones were the most popular for bachelor's degree seekers in the field of family and community services. When you put them all together, these colleges and universities awarded 48 bachelor's degrees in family and community services during the 2019-2020 academic year.

Merrimack College is a popular decision for students interested in a bachelor's degree in family and community services. Merrimack is a medium-sized private not-for-profit college located in the large suburb of North Andover. Potential students might also be interested to know that the school ranks #1 in quality for bachelor's degrees in family and community services in Massachusetts.
